Responsibilities

  • Financial Modeling: Develop, maintain, and enhance financial models to support budgeting, forecasting, and strategic business decisions across the Ag-Chemicals division and broader FBN operations.
  • OPEX & Variance Analysis: Assist in leading the OPEX lifecycle by supporting monthly, quarterly, and annual Budget vs. Actual (BvA) variance analyses — identifying cost drivers, pinpointing savings opportunities, and helping craft the “story behind the numbers” for senior stakeholders.
  • Data Analysis & Business Intelligence (BI): Utilize Tableau (and SQL) to extract, manipulate, and analyze large financial datasets, identifying trends, risks, and opportunities. Support the design and maintenance of dynamic financial dashboards and performance reports.
  • Reporting & Presentation Preparation: Prepare comprehensive financial analyses, reports, and presentations for senior management, clearly communicating complex financial information and actionable insights.
  • Performance Monitoring & KPI Tracking: Assist in tracking and analyzing key performance indicators (KPIs) and financial results against budget and forecast, explaining variances and driving accountability across business units.
  • Strategic Planning & Forecasting Support: Support the coordination of bottom-up OPEX budgeting and annual operating plan (AOP) processes. Assist with rolling forecast updates and scenario analysis.
  • Cross-Functional Business Partnering: Serve as a liaison across departments to gather inputs, align financial targets, and provide financial support to ensure that organizational goals are met — including building OPEX assumptions, tracking costs, and proposing month-end accruals.
  • Financial Systems Exposure (NetSuite & PBCS): Gain exposure to and work within Oracle NetSuite (ERP) and Oracle PBCS (Planning and Budgeting Cloud Service) to ensure data integrity and seamless information flow across financial systems.
  • Process Improvement: Identify opportunities to streamline and automate FP&A reporting processes and planning workflows for increased efficiency and accuracy.
  • Ad-Hoc Projects & Analysis: Provide analytical support for various ad-hoc financial initiatives, mergers and acquisitions due diligence, and other special projects at the request of senior management.
